Preparing Your Labrador Puppy for Contests

Basic Obedience Training is a Must

Sit, Stay, Come – The Basics Matter

Foundational commands like “sit,” “stay,” and “come” help your puppy maintain focus amid distractions during contests. Training should start at home, gradually adding more stimuli.

Socialization with Other Dogs

Expose your Labrador to different breeds and environments in a controlled way. This ensures confident, calm behavior during group events.

Grooming and Presentation Tips

A freshly brushed coat, trimmed nails, clean ears, and bright eyes make a significant impression. Even for informal photo contests, grooming can make the difference.

Are These Contests Safe for Young Labradors?

Safety Guidelines to Keep in Mind

Plan for hydration, timed breaks, sun protection, and a shade spot. Think of it like puppy-first-aid.

Watch for Signs of Puppy Stress

Lab signs: panting, yawning, shying away, whining. If noticeable, pause or wrap it up early. Refer to puppy-stress resources and health wellness tips.

FAQs

1. Are Labrador Retriever puppy contests expensive to enter?
Many are free or cost a small fee—especially online—they’re budget-friendly and fun!

2. What age should my puppy be to enter a contest?
At least 8 weeks old, fully socialized, and up-to-date on vaccinations.

3. Do I need professional photos for contests?
Not necessarily! Bright, clear phone shots in good light work well—AKC contests accept them too akc.org.

4. How do I find local Labrador puppy contests?
Check with local dog-friendly cafes, pet stores, vet offices, and regional pet social media groups.

5. What should I bring to an in-person contest?
Bring water, treats, a leash, poop bags, and a cozy mat for your pup to relax on.

6. What if my puppy is shy around other dogs?
Start with virtual or home contests. Gradually introduce calm, controlled social settings before attending live events.
